研究概览

简要总结

Non-invasive sensors have been used in research in the United States (US) to aid in the assessment of a subject's heart rate (HR), respiratory rate (RR) and fluid volume status. This estimate and its trended value over time, when used along with clinical signs and symptoms and other subject test results, can aid in the process of reaching a diagnosis and formulating a therapeutic plan when abnormalities of volume status, or RR are suspected.

Non-invasive sensors like the Peripheral IntraVenous Analysis (PIVA) sensor under development by Baxter and the Deltran blood pressure (BP) transducer, capture waveforms created by physiological mechanisms such as blood flow and breathing. An algorithm is then applied to the captured waveform to give clinicians an idea of hemodynamic (volume) status, and RR.

In this study, the functional robustness (e.g., subjects sitting, elevated leg positions, etc.) of the PIVA algorithm/technology will be demonstrated by evaluating the impact of various common interventions on the venous pressure signal. All subjects will undergo 33 interventions expected to take approximately 4 - 6 hours.

结局指标

主要结局

Signal Quality Index (SQI) Score by Supine, Sitting, Standing Body Positions

时间窗: End of interventions #15 (supine for 5 minutes), #17 (sitting for 5 minutes), and #19 (standing for 5 minutes)

Ranking of subject body positions (supine, sitting, standing) based upon their impact on the venous waveform signal, from best to worst, based on the PIVA algorithm-derived SQI. Score on the scale include 0=no signal, 1=poor signal, 2=good signal. The highest percentage of time with good signal quality will be the best ranked position, and the lowest percentage of time with good signal quality will be the worst ranked position.
